The structure of Y-Al13-xCo4 (x=0.8) analyzed by single crystal X-ray diffraction coupled with anomalous X-ray scattering

摘要
The structure of Y-Al13-xCo4 (x=0.8) has been analyzed by single crystal X-ray diffraction: space group C2/m (No.12), a=17.0525 (20)angstrom, 6=4.1059(6)angstrom, c=7.5047(9)angstrom, beta=116.01(1)degrees. Y- Al13-0.8Co4 is isostructural with a ternary Y-A113-x(Co,Ni)4 and crystallized at the Al-poor region close to Al(13)Co4. The distribution of Co was also confirmed by anomalous X-ray scattering (AXS) at Co K absorption edge. Present analysis revealed the Co distribution at Co(1) and Co(2) sites, only, by suggesting unique pentagonal atomic columns with a period of 4 angstrom different from that observed in Al11Co4.
